    What Are CBD Capsules?

    CBD capsules have a gelatin outer casing and are infused with a precise amount of CBD oil. CBD is an organic chemical compound obtained from hemp. It is popular due to its non-psychoactive benefits; thus, it does not cause a 'high' sensation when consumed. It is imperative to distinguish that hemp and marijuana are plant strains of the cannabis plant, but they have varying effects and chemical components. For example, marijuana has higher levels of THC (tetrahydrocannabinol), an organic chemical compound with euphoric effects that temporarily alter the user's mental state. In contrast, hemp has higher levels of CBD, which is non-psychoactive and has several therapeutic benefits.

    CBD capsules contain other essential chemical compounds, such as terpenes and flavonoids. Terpenes are organic chemical compounds found in plants and are responsible for their distinct scent. Cox-Georgian et al. (2019) observed that they have anti-inflammatory properties that alleviate muscle and skin inflammation. Moreover, flavonoids alleviate oxidative stress in the muscles and tissues.

    CBD Capsules Dosage Guide

    CBD capsules are available in several potencies. Some capsules contain 10mg of CBD oil, while others contain as much as 50mg of CBD oil. While using higher potency CBD capsules, you'll only need to consume fewer capsules. It is necessary to consult your doctors concerning the right dosage since they can examine any possible allergies and your tolerance to cannabidiol. The following are variables that determine how many CBD capsules you should consume:

    The Health Condition Being Addressed

    Moltke & Hindocha (2021) suggested that CBD has several therapeutic effects, such as pain relief, reduced anxiety, and improved sleep quality. The condition being addressed would determine the amount of CBD capsules to be taken. To improve sleep quality and reduce insomnia, consume 10-25 mg CBD capsules. For anxiety relief, 20-30mg of CBD would be effective.

    CBD capsules can also improve your concentration, and consuming 10-20mg of CBD is advisable for an almost guaranteed efficacy. While alleviating pain and inflammation, 10-50 mg of CBD capsules may be effective, depending on the type and intensity of pain.

    Bioavailability

    Bioavailability refers to the amount of CBD absorbed into the bloodstream. Various CBD consumption methods have different bioavailabilities. For example, CBD tinctures and vapes have a higher bioavailability since they do not have to be gut processed. Therefore, they don't have to undergo first-pass metabolism in the liver and are absorbed into the bloodstream almost directly.

    However, oral CBD consumption methods, such as capsules, have a slower bioavailability since they have to be gut processed before being absorbed into the bloodstream. However, their effects can last for 3-6 hours in the body, making the more effective.

    Type of CBD Capsules

    CBD capsules are available in several spectra, including full spectrum, CBD isolate, and broad-spectrum CBD capsules

    Full-spectrum CBD capsules contain several cannabinoids and chemical compounds, including terpenes, flavonoids, CBD, THC, and CBC (cannabichromene). However, the levels of THC are relatively lower to prevent any psychoactive effects.

    Broad-spectrum CBD capsules are similar to full-spectrum CBD capsules. However, they do not contain THC since it is removed after the initial extraction process.

    CBD isolate capsules are considered the purest since they only contain cannabidiol as the primary chemical compound.  

    Full-spectrum and broad-spectrum CBD capsules exhibit the entourage effect. They have similar chemical compounds that work harmoniously to enhance CBD's therapeutic effects. Therefore, it is easier to determine the right dosage of CBD to consume while using full-spectrum or broad-spectrum CBD capsules.

    How Do CBD Capsules Work?

    The CBD extract interacts with the endocannabinoid system after the capsules have undergone first-pass metabolism. The endocannabinoid system is a complex system that regulates various body functions like digestion, sleep, and metabolism, ensuring they remain in a homeostatic state. It comprises receptors such as CB1 and CB2, enzymes, and endocannabinoids such as anandamide. CBD binds indirectly with CB2 receptors, which are abundant in the peripheral nervous system, alleviating pain and inflammation by transmitting signals to pain receptors in the body. CBD also improves sleep quality by enhancing anandamide's function and triggering increased serotonin production.
